Garmin · GPSMAP 8616xsv

GPSMAP 8616xsv

A 16-inch full-HD multifunction display with built-in sonar, extensive network integration and large multi-pane helm capacity

Ready to buy

Confirm the exact machine and complete setup

The retained reference is About $5,599.99 current U.S. reference. Transducer, radar, modules, charts and professional installation are separate. Confirm the current configuration, included parts, support path, return terms and the work that must be preserved before ordering.

Current verdict

The large Garmin system flagship

GPSMAP 8616xsv belongs at a networked helm where its screen can coordinate several sensors and boat systems.

Owner experience

What repeats after the purchase

Owner discussion repeatedly returns to system complexity, software updates and service access rather than specifications alone.

These are self-reported experiences from a changing mix of owners, conditions and software versions. They identify questions to test, not a failure rate.
SignalWhat owners reportOur readEvidence

system complexity, software updates and service access

Owners repeatedly discuss transducer turbulence, interference, map regions, software updates, connector corrosion, voltage drop, Ethernet ports, trolling-motor ecosystems, installation cost and dealer support.

Treat the display as one node in a commissioned helm rather than a standalone electronics purchase.

Current fishfinder and chartplotter marketCurrent manufacturer stores · price

Current listings show that the same display name can be sold without a transducer, with scanning sonar, with live sonar or inside a radar bundle, making the exact part number essential.
